Lead Presenter Biography
MARK T. JOHNSON P.E. (many states) P.Eng.
MTJ Roundabout Consulting
Mark has 30 years of experience integrating roundabouts into transportation systems through the application of traffic, roadway, active modes, and roundabout disciplines.
Following 12 years in the private and public sectors of traffic, planning, and transportation engineering, including his tenure at the Wisconsin Department of Transportation, where he played a key role in developing the department's first roundabout program, Mark founded MTJ Roundabout Consulting in 2005. At MTJ, he collaborates with agencies and consultant-led project teams to provide roundabout services that support the successful implementation of well-received multi-modal roundabout solutions, enhancing our communities.
Mark's expertise encompasses a full range of contexts and applications, including single-lane, multi-lane, hybrid, compact, mini, and various types of roundabouts, such as turbo and peanut-shaped designs. Mark's work promotes sound decision-making across all design applications, including alternative evaluations, peer reviews, and direct designs.
Mark has authored and published several application-specific research and practice-ready publications on key roundabout topics, including operational analysis, geometrics, multi-modal safety, signing, and pavement markings. Additionally, Mark offers roundabout training, mentorship, and workshops to encourage the effective implementation of roundabouts.
